Originally Posted by CozmoRX7
dang i had no idea that they were rare my 86 i just sold had one on it and i have another one layin around my garage too
They are cast aluminum for all 1986 - 1988 FC's.
See the original post - it says "S5", which are 1989 - 1991 models.
All Kouki 13B's use plastic thermostat covers - 3-bolt pattern.
